 Scientists have developed what they claim is a 15-minute online test which can help detect the early signs of Alzheimer's disease. A team at Oxford University has developed the online quiz called the Cognitive Function Test which it claims could help diagnose the most common form of dementia perhaps years earlier than it might normally be spotted... Click here to visit our Dementia news pages... Brain Game - Alphabet Jungle 

 
 

The instructions for this game are on the start up screen, but basically what you need to do in this game is to identify as many words as possible that can be made from the letters provided.

Once you have worked out some words that can be made from the letters, simply type them in and either hit the enter key after each word or click on the 'Submit' button. You can select your level, and you are timed.

If you don't reach the goal number of words for the level you are playing at, the little man on the left of the screen will become someone's dinner because as the timer ticks down, so too, he is lowered closer and closer to the boiling pot!

If you have run out of words and don't want to wait for the timer to tick down, you can still end the game at that point to get your score.
